Environment – Shawcity EVM

Shawcity describes the EVM, which was on show at SHE 11 last week, as a rugged and easy-to-use environmental monitor that combines several instruments in one. It can, says the company, simultaneously measure and data-log particulates, Volatile Organic Compounds, toxic gas, CO2, relative humidity, temperature and air velocity, thus reducing the need for multiple instruments.

The dial-in impactor allows easy selection of particulate settings PM2.5, PM4, PM10 or TSP, without disassembly, says Shawcity. A built-in sampling pump helps collect particulates, while a photometer provides real-time measurement. A standard 37mm filter cassette offers gravimetric sampling and lab analysis.

Sampling sessions and studies stored in the internal memory can later be downloaded into QSP II datalogging software for analysis, charting and graphing, adds the company.
